I have a very large Duncan, probably 50 or so heads, that I've had for over 3 years. 3 weeks ago it closed up and hasn't opened since. It has at least doubled in size in the time I've had it and never stayed closed before. All my sps corals are growing very well; some monties have grown an inch since December. Several frags I cut in December have doubled in size and plated down over the rock. I have read several other people say similar things have happened to theirs but until it reopens I am still concerned.

Other things of note:
Anemones don't do well in my tank. They seem to shrink to small blobs over a few months.

I do have some brown diatom algae as well as some red cyanobacteria. Neither in any real significant amounts.

SPS grow very well. Mushrooms do "ok". Some LPS do well and others do not.
